Programmes can often go off track and fail. Large scale, complex and IT enabled programmes are the most likely victims. The consequences for organisations can be disastrous – hitting cash flow and bottom line results, damaging reputation with customers and diminishing morale within the business. The problem is that most businesses either do not recognise the symptoms of failure early enough, or do not know what actions to take to recover or even salvage a failing project.
Programme Recovery is different from ‘normal’ project management. Recovery projects usually have high visibility at Board level, they get talked about widely as people like to speculate and second guess the outcomes and stress levels increase.
There will be a sense of urgency and a need to take measured short cuts and apply rapid recovery techniques if a programme is to deliver to its original or revised objectives. Experience is knowing how to get it right first time is essential.
